Abstract (en)
[origin: US4852523A] An atmospheric gas boiler has two vertically arranged end pieces and at least one middle piece arranged between them, as well as burner lances disposed in the lower part of the gas boiler. The pieces of the boiler through which hot water flows define a furnace, with secondary heating surfaces adjoining thereto. In order to lower the quantity of NOX arising during the combustion, the middle piece has a tongue through which hot water flows, extending into the furnace. The tongue possesses cooling ribs on the outside, which extend into the adjoining furnace spaces.
